Date:Monday 1 August 1932
Time:
Type:Boeing F4B-2
Owner/operator:US Navy
Registration: A-8806
MSN: 1454
Fatalities:Fatalities: 0 / Occupants: 1
Aircraft damage: Destroyed
Location:San Diego Bay, CA -   United States of America
Phase: En route
Nature:Military
Departure airport:North Island NAS, San Diego, CA
Destination airport:
Narrative:
Lost control in a dive at 1000ft and crashed in the bay. The pilot bailed out safely.
